Covenant Technologies, a leader in IT and Cybersecurity staffing, proudly announces the formation of its parent company, Covenant HR, alongside the debut of Scout™, an innovative recruitment technology designed to redefine how organizations approach hiring. With its expanded capabilities beyond the IT and Cybersecurity sectors, Scout™ is already attracting significant attention from industries such as enterprise staffing and healthcare, underscoring its broad appeal and transformative potential.
Building on its reputation for delivering exceptional hiring results—boasting a 93% success rate in presenting first candidate submissions within 3-5 business days—Covenant HR is tackling one of recruitment’s most persistent challenges: ensuring every candidate has a fair chance while meeting increasingly aggressive hiring needs. Scout™ revolutionizes the process by leveraging speed, precision, and AI-driven insights, helping HR professionals fill roles faster with highly qualified candidates. This measurable reduction in time-to-hire not only improves efficiency but also delivers a significant ROI, especially for organizations managing multiple open positions.

Expanded Board and Leadership
To support its ambitious goals, Covenant Technologies, as a Covenant HR division, has expanded its board of directors to include experienced leaders who will help to guide both Covenant Technologies and the newly formed Covenant HR.
Among the late 2024 additions to Covenant is Dan Dolan, an accomplished executive with over 30 years of expertise in executive search, leadership development, and talent optimization across industries such as automotive, aerospace, and technology. From 2009 to September 2024, Dan served as Managing Director and CEO of A. Raymond North America, where he drove business development, operational strategy, and tactical planning. Under his leadership, teams across three countries achieved significant growth and profitability, generating $300 million in revenue. “I’m thrilled to join Covenant at this transformative moment,” said Dolan. “The company’s commitment to innovation and its human-centered approach are setting a new industry standard.”
